Lines Matching refs:dir_ni

127 	ntfs_inode *dir_ni;	
130 dir_ni = ntfs_inode_open(ns->ntvol, parent);
131 if (dir_ni) {
138 inum = ntfs_inode_lookup_by_name(dir_ni, uname, uname_len);
144 if (ntfs_inode_close(dir_ni)
163 ntfs_inode *dir_ni = NULL;
169 dir_ni = ntfs_inode_open(ns->ntvol, parent);
170 if (!dir_ni) {
181 iref = ntfs_inode_lookup_by_name(dir_ni, uname, uname_len);
198 if (ntfs_delete(ns->ntvol, (char*)NULL, ni, dir_ni, uname, uname_len))
200 /* ntfs_delete() always closes ni and dir_ni */
201 ni = dir_ni = NULL;
205 if (dir_ni != NULL)
206 ntfs_inode_close(dir_ni);
1054 ntfs_inode *dir_ni = NULL;
1078 dir_ni = ntfs_inode_open(ns->ntvol, dir->vnid);
1079 if (dir_ni == NULL) {
1084 if (!(dir_ni->mrec->flags & MFT_RECORD_IS_DIRECTORY)) {
1104 ni = ntfs_pathname_to_inode(ns->ntvol, dir_ni, name);
1120 ni = ntfs_create(dir_ni, securid, uname, unameLength, S_IFREG);
1139 if (ntfs_inode_close_in_dir(ni, dir_ni)) {
1154 fs_ntfs_update_times(_vol, dir_ni, NTFS_UPDATE_MCTIME);
1166 if (dir_ni != NULL)
1167 ntfs_inode_close(dir_ni);
1498 ntfs_inode *dir_ni = NULL;
1520 dir_ni = ntfs_inode_open(ns->ntvol, dir->vnid);
1521 if (dir_ni == NULL) {
1538 ni = ntfs_create_symlink(dir_ni, securid, uname, unameLength, utarget,
1549 newNode->parent_vnid = MREF(dir_ni->mft_no);
1559 if (ntfs_inode_close_in_dir(ni, dir_ni)) {
1565 fs_ntfs_update_times(_vol, dir_ni, NTFS_UPDATE_MCTIME);
1566 notify_entry_created(ns->id, MREF(dir_ni->mft_no), name, vnid);
1571 if (dir_ni != NULL)
1572 ntfs_inode_close(dir_ni);
1595 ntfs_inode *dir_ni = NULL;
1613 dir_ni = ntfs_inode_open(ns->ntvol, dir->vnid);
1614 if (dir_ni == NULL) {
1619 if (!(dir_ni->mrec->flags & MFT_RECORD_IS_DIRECTORY)) {
1630 ni = ntfs_create(dir_ni, securid, uname, unameLength, S_IFDIR);
1641 newNode->parent_vnid = MREF(dir_ni->mft_no);
1651 if (ntfs_inode_close_in_dir(ni, dir_ni)) {
1657 fs_ntfs_update_times(_vol, dir_ni, NTFS_UPDATE_MCTIME);
1658 notify_entry_created(ns->id, MREF(dir_ni->mft_no), name, vnid);
1663 if (dir_ni != NULL)
1664 ntfs_inode_close(dir_ni);
1692 ntfs_inode *dir_ni = NULL;
1735 dir_ni = ntfs_inode_open(ns->ntvol, newparent_vnid);
1736 if (!dir_ni) {
1741 if (ntfs_link(ni, dir_ni, uname, uname_len)) {
1749 fs_ntfs_update_times(_vol, dir_ni, NTFS_UPDATE_MCTIME);
1760 ntfs_inode_close(dir_ni);
1791 ntfs_inode *dir_ni = NULL;
1852 dir_ni = ntfs_inode_open(ns->ntvol, dir->vnid);
1853 if (dir_ni != NULL) {
1854 fs_ntfs_update_times(_vol, dir_ni, NTFS_UPDATE_MCTIME);
1855 ntfs_inode_close(dir_ni);
1878 ntfs_inode *dir_ni = NULL;
1922 dir_ni = ntfs_inode_open(ns->ntvol, dir->vnid);
1923 if (dir_ni != NULL) {
1924 fs_ntfs_update_times(_vol, dir_ni, NTFS_UPDATE_MCTIME);
1925 ntfs_inode_close(dir_ni);